The Gas Cylinder: A Key Player in Firearm Functionality

So, you've put the barrel in place—great! But before you start closing any covers, there’s one crucial step you absolutely can’t skip: aligning the gas cylinder. You might be asking yourself, “Why do I need to worry about that?” Well, here’s the thing: the alignment of the gas cylinder affects how the entire gas system operates. Think of it as tuning a musical instrument; if it’s out of sync, even the best-made firearm won't perform as it should.

Proper alignment ensures that gases expelled from the cartridge travel through the gas system efficiently, allowing the firearm to cycle properly. If mishaps occur here, you’re not just risking a malfunction; you could end up dealing with reduced performance when you pull the trigger. And who wants a firearm that can’t reliably do its job? The Order of Operations: Why It Matters

Now, you might wonder why aligning the gas cylinder comes before other important checks, like checking the safety or inspecting the chamber. Here’s a bit of insight: once you seal those covers, you may find it tricky to access certain components again. It’s like trying to repair a car after you’ve closed the hood—things become a lot more complicated, don’t you think?

This sequence of steps is crucial for both safety and efficiency. After all, you want everything in place, working harmoniously together. Remember, in the world of firearms, precision is not just desirable; it’s absolutely necessary.
